以 root 账号进入 mysql,
use mysql;
grant all privileges on *.* to 某个用户 @"%" identified by "用户密码";
flush privileges;
其中*.*
是将所有的数据库赋予某个用户 也可以指定某个库database.*
其中"%"
是允许远程连接的 IP 地址 如果不想控制具体某个 ip 就使用"%"
如果 flush 后仍然链接不上的话建议重启 mysql 服务
如果还不行请关闭防火墙
sudo services iptables stop